I had 22x10 Lowenhart LD-1 3 piece wheels on my 95 Impala SS with 265/30/22 and rear tires were 1/16th away from the rockers , anything bigger would shred the tires without cutting the body or installing SLP extended rear control arms.

315 tires are too wide for a 9.5 wheel in my opinion. I'd say 10.5 is the low end on width range, with 11.0 being perfect.
